Whether you are looking for a spot to relax with your family or a weekend getaway with the girls, this is the place for you! Log Cabin Haus is located close by to the Pumpkinvine Nature Trail where you can walk or bring your bicycles and enjoy a bike ride on one of the best trails around. Downtown Shipshewana is a two minute drive away with eateries, fun shoppes, and an outdoor flea market, open May through September. Shipshewana is also home to Bluegate Theater and the Michiana Event Center. There is so much to see and do while you stay right here in the heart of Amish country in Shipshewana, Indiana.
The house is all one level. The full kitchen includes a refrigerator, oven/stove, microwave, dishwasher, coffee maker, with a drip side or K cup (coffee is provided), toaster, dishes, pots, and pans. The dining area includes a dining table with six dining chairs. There are additional folding chairs available to pull up around the table. The living room has a cozy sectional and loveseat. All bedrooms and bathrooms are located in the hallway off of the living room. The ensuite primary bedroom has a King bed, clothes closet, shower, jetted bathtub, and a double vanity. The other two bedrooms both have a queen bed, clothes closet, and a pedestal sink.
The second bathroom includes a Walk-in bath tub with detachable shower head and a pedestal sink. The washer and dryer is also located in this bathroom.
